What is Formation Steward?

The term formation steward refers to specialized training programs designed to prepare individuals for the roles and responsibilities of cabin crew members. In France, these programs integrate practical training, theoretical knowledge, and soft skills development, ensuring that aspiring stewards and stewardesses receive a well-rounded education.

The Role of a Steward

Stewards play a crucial role on commercial flights, managing various aspects of passenger safety and comfort. Their responsibilities include:

  • Safety Procedures: Stewards are trained to handle emergency situations, conduct safety demonstrations, and ensure compliance with aviation regulations.
  • Customer Service: Providing exceptional customer service is paramount. Stewards must cater to the needs of passengers, addressing their concerns and providing assistance throughout the flight.
  • Food and Beverage Service: Stewards are responsible for serving meals and beverages, ensuring passengers have a pleasant dining experience while flying.
  • Health and Safety: Maintaining a clean and safe environment in the cabin is key. Stewards must manage in-flight hygiene and address any health-related concerns.

The Structure of Formation Steward Programs in France

In France, the training programs for stewards are both comprehensive and practical. They typically cover several essential areas:

1. Theoretical Knowledge

Theoretical components of the training include:

  • Regulatory Compliance: Understanding FAA regulations and other relevant air transport laws.
  • Aviation Medicine: Learning about in-flight medical emergencies, including first aid, and how to assist passengers with health issues.
  • Customer Service Excellence: Techniques and strategies to enhance the passenger experience.

2. Practical Training

While theoretical knowledge is important, practical skills are equally critical. Practical training involves:

  • Simulation Exercises: Role-playing scenarios that replicate potential in-flight situations, catering to diverse customer needs and emergencies.
  • On-the-Job Training: Experience working alongside experienced stewards and stewardesses during actual flights.
  • Catering and Service Procedures: Mastering the logistics of meal and beverage service in a confined space.

3. Soft Skills Development

Soft skills are integral to a successful career as a steward. The training programs focus on:

  • Communication Skills: Effective interaction with passengers from various cultural backgrounds.
  • Conflict Resolution: Techniques for managing difficult situations and resolving passenger complaints.
  • Cultural Awareness: Understanding and respecting the diverse backgrounds of passengers.

The Significance of Formation Steward in Career Development

Engaging in a formation steward program in France does not only equip trainees with essential skills for their immediate roles but also lays the foundation for further career growth within the aviation industry. Completion of such a program can lead to various opportunities, including:

  • Promotion to Senior Steward Positions: With experience and demonstrated skill, stewards can advance to supervisory roles.
  • Specialized Roles: Opportunities exist within airlines for stewards to transition into training roles, safety monitoring, or management positions.
  • International Opportunities: Skilled and trained stewards may find opportunities to work with international airlines, expanding their career horizon.
